At a median of €3750/m², this neighborhood is the definition of BOUGIE and has the price tag to prove it. You aren't buying here for a bargain; you're buying for the city's most stable investment outlook and the prestige of a high-ceilinged flat. If you see house prices dipping toward the €3100/m² mark, the property likely lacks an elevator or faces a dark interior patio—standard m² stats for this district rarely drop without a catch.

The Vibe:This is Valencia’s upscale grid, defined by wide avenues, modernist facades, and a demographic that prefers tailored suits over fast fashion. Life here is dictated by the proximity to the high-end retail on Calle Colón and the social scene around Gran Vía Marqués del Turia. Expect high-pressure competition for street parking and a streetscape where the architectural prestige is matched only by the price of a gin tonic at Mercado de Colón.

The median property price in l'Eixample, Valencia is 3,750 per m², 3% above the Valencia city average of €3650/m². Based on 3 verified sale data points as of February 2026.

Locals Ask

Is the €5750/m² top-end price actually justified?

Only for renovated penthouses on streets like Conde Salvatierra; anything else at that price is just an owner testing their luck.

How does the investment outlook compare to neighboring Ruzafa?

Eixample is more defensive and less volatile, making it better for wealth preservation than speculative flipping.

Can I find any new build house prices here?

Almost never; the neighborhood is fully built out, so you are looking at 'rehabilitated' projects rather than fresh construction.

What should I look for in the m² stats for a 'good' deal?

Finding a flat with a terrace or balcony for under €3800/m² is a win, as outside space is rare in these traditional blocks.

Is car ownership realistic in l'Eixample?

Only if you rent or buy a garage space separately; street parking is a daily exercise in frustration.
